AltGrキーを使用して{}、@などの特殊文字を書き込もうとして問題が発生しました。システム全体の問題ではなく、Android Studio IDEで発生し、Android Studio IDE using this 答え。
しかし、その答えは、一部の新しいキーボードにはAltGrキーがないため、その存在に依存しないソフトウェアもあるということです。この種のことは、英語以外のキーボードでこれらの{} <> [] @&のような特殊文字を書き込む別の方法があることを意味します。
特殊文字を挿入するたびに入力言語を変更したり、alt = numpadのコンボを使用してASCIIコードをパンチインする必要がある)以外に、実際にそのような方法があるのかと思っていました。
明確にするために、私はチェコ語キーボードとWindowsを持っていますが、答えますOSXも同様にいただければ幸いです。
単純な答えは使用することです Ctrl + Alt の代わりに Alt Gr。これは、キーボードのすべての特殊文字で機能します。
あなたが参照しているキーボードのレイアウト(それは持っていません)を想像します Alt Gr キー)は、各キーに2つのバージョンの入力文字、つまり通常の文字と、 Shift。
一般的な方法は次のとおりです。最速ではありませんが、キーボードレイアウトに関係なく、すべての文字に対して:
必要な文字がUSキーボードで簡単に利用できると仮定します。